Netflix-ordered dubs have had some pretty good casting pulls from people who don't usually do anime work. Giancarlo Esposito in Edgerunners, Keith David in Pluto, Corey Burton in this episode of Dungeon Meshi. And they bring their own vibes and takes on the characters in ways I like.

Corey Burton has been in the voiceover business for decades but I think this might have been the first time I've heard him in an anime. When the gnome professor started talking I said "Count Dooku?" because I kept hearing hints of his Clone Wars voices. Games and cartoons can keep plenty of voice actors busy so it's fun when they pop up in other spots.

Digamma-F-Wau
Mar 22, 2016

It is curious and wants to accept all kinds of challenges
yeah it looks like this is his first anime; the closest we've gotten before this was some of his video game roles being dubs (mainly the Kingdom Hearts series, and even then it was mainly him voicing his usual Disney characters like Chip and Yen Sid as well as taking over Christopher Lee's role as Ansem the Wise)
